On Wednesday, June 17, at approximately 10:30 p.m., the Idaho State Police investigated an injury crash at the intersection of US93 and 3800 N, in Twin Falls County.

Douglas Howell, 25, of Jerome, was traveling southbound on US93 in a 2008 Pontiac G6.
Kisha Miszczenko, 38, of Twin Falls, was traveling westbound on 3800 N in a 2002 Chrysler Cruiser.
Kisha failed to stop at the intersection and was struck on the passenger side by Howell's vehicle.

Kisha was not wearing a seatbelt and was transported by air ambulance to St. Alphonsus Medical Center in Boise.
Douglas was wearing a seatbelt and was transported by ground ambulance to St. Alphonsus Magic Valley.

The roadway was blocked for approximately 1 hr.

The crash is currently under investigation by Idaho State Police.
